Google has launched a new AI tool to help people plan their gardens. The tool is free and easy to use. It works through Google Search. Users type in what they want to grow or describe their outdoor space. The AI then gives planting suggestions based on location, sunlight, soil type, and season.

This feature uses data from local weather patterns and gardening experts. It also considers plant compatibility. For example, it might recommend pairing tomatoes with basil because they grow well together. The tool adjusts its advice for beginners and experienced gardeners alike.

To start, users open Google Search on their phone or computer. They type a question like “What can I plant in my backyard in June?” or “Garden ideas for small spaces.” The AI responds with a custom layout, plant list, and care tips. Users can change details like sun exposure or garden size to get updated suggestions.

The tool includes photos and step-by-step guides. It shows where to place each plant and how much space they need. It also reminds users when to water or harvest. All information appears right in the search results. No app download is needed.

Google built this tool to make gardening more accessible. Many people want to grow food or flowers but do not know where to start. The AI removes guesswork. It helps users avoid common mistakes like planting too close together or choosing plants that need more sun than they have.

People across the United States are already using the tool. Feedback shows it saves time and boosts confidence. Garden centers and local nurseries report more informed customers asking better questions. Google says it will keep improving the tool with more plant types and regional advice.
